I'm having a strange problem with linmpeg3 while compiling DJplay
(http://linux1.t-data.com/djplay/)

All goes well until the final linker step which gives this error: 

g++ -o djplay djplay.o display.o [...] mp3.o [...]  recorder.o \
-L$QTDIR/lib -lqt-mt `pkg-config --libs glib jack` -laudiofile -lmad \
-lmpeg3

mp3.o(.text+0x4ac): In function `mpeg3demux_read_char':
/usr/include/mpeg3demux.h:104: undefined reference to `mpeg3demux_read_char_packet(mpeg3_demuxer_t*)'
mp3.o(.text+0x4e9): In function `mpeg3demux_read_prev_char':
/usr/include/mpeg3demux.h:118: undefined reference to `mpeg3demux_read_prev_char_packet(mpeg3_demuxer_t*)'
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
make: *** [djplay] Error 1

This is using the Debian testing packages of libmpeg3. I als tried
recompiling the library, but it still gives this error. Anone any tips
on where to look for the error?
